Transaction 69dba3494b25af95098525f5199b43395525972f3086d1235eac16e8ead7ce7b

1 Input
2 Outputs
  • 69dba3494b25af95098525f5199b43395525972f3086d1235eac16e8ead7ce7b:0
  • value  41508519
    address  13TDF4z8gpBMjAZr5hMV6BxWyS7wmA5cs7
  • 69dba3494b25af95098525f5199b43395525972f3086d1235eac16e8ead7ce7b:1
  • value  70764630
    address  3LvqWMdmwekFapxTxhLn5WXM5gZd6Vay4A